For those of you who have spent New Years Eve in Epcot what tips do you have? We plan to get there at opening and ride as much as we can and we have a dining reservation for lunch at San Angel Inn. Can we expect that by evening it will be impossible to ride any rides even the less popular rides and can we expect that fast passes will be gone for Everything by late morning? Also, is it hard to get a good spot to view Illuminations? One more thing, do we dare leave the park in the afternoon and return later or should we plan to stay in the park all day? Thanks for any advice you can give me.
 
Get there EARLY!!! Hit fast passes for the rides you'll want to ride...
When I went we went in at gates opening and went straight to Mission:Space and had to wait in a 20min ride just to get a fastpass, and already had to wait like 4 hours until we could ride!

It is hard to find a good spot, just stake some ground early and you'll be OK, it'll be very worth it as NYE Illuminations was the most amazing show I have ever seen... It was like daylight there were so many fireworks!!!

All-in-all it was an awesome time, and UNBELIEVABLY packed! Have fun!
 
We are going for NYE as well. We are planning on going to EPCOT in the AM and then getting an ADR for dinner at LeCellier. What day can you start making reservations for NYE? Is it still the 90 day window?
 

If you are a resort guest you can make all your adr's in one phone call once you are 90 days from your check in date, I just did this a couple of days ago and got everything I wanted with one phone call, it was great!
 
Don't want to spoil your NYE but we were in Epcot on NYE several years ago (maybe 10??) along with the entire country of Brazil. :rotfl2: You couldn't turn around let alone walk anywhere. They had passed out plastic horns at the entrance in late afternoon and it was so loud you couldn't even hear anything. We went back to the hotel and watched a football game! Never again!!

Hope you have a better experience than we did!
